Weather in February
Lima (Coast)
- Temperature: 22-29C (72-84F)
- Rain: Lima rarely rains (desert climate)
- Conditions: Warm and sunny, beach weather
Cusco & Highlands
- Temperature: 7-18C (45-64F)
- Rainfall: Heaviest (150mm)

Highlights & Reasons to Visit in February
- Carnival celebrations
- cheapest prices
- fewest tourists
- Pisco Sour Day (first Saturday)
- lush scenery
Things to Watch Out For
- Inca Trail closed
- heaviest rainfall month
- some roads/trails impassable
- flooding possible in some areas
Who Should Visit in February
Best For
Budget travelers, festival lovers (Carnival), Lima visitors, those avoiding crowds entirely
Avoid If
You want outdoor trekking, you need reliable mountain weather, you plan to do the Inca Trail

Costs & Budget in February
February is low season for prices. Expect deals on accommodation and tours.
- Budget traveler: $40-$60/day
- Mid-range: $80-$150/day
- Luxury: $200-$400+/day
